Milan Kulung and Anjuli Gurung have won the Langtang Trail Run-2026 title in the men's category and Anjuli Gurung in the women's category.

Kulung and Gurung won the title in the 32-kilometer race held on Saturday from Kyanjen Gumba to Syafrubensi under Gosainkunda Rural Municipality of Rasuwa. Milan Kulung won the first place in the men's category by completing the race in 2 hours 16 minutes 43 seconds. Dhir Bahadur Budha came in second place (2 hours 18 minutes 47 seconds) and Bishal Rai came in third place, the Rasuwa-Nuwakot Tourism Society said in a press release. Gopal Tamang came in fourth place and Chandra Rawat came in fifth place.

Anjuli Gurung won the first place in the women's category by completing the race in 4 hours 45 minutes 03 seconds. Suraksha Tamang came in second place. Austrian athlete Anna Lena Furtner came in third place. Geeta Maharjan (5 hours 37 minutes 28 seconds) and Sonu Poudel (6 hours 16 minutes 40 seconds) were in fourth place and fifth place respectively.

The first place in the competition was awarded 100,000 rupees,  75,000 rupees for the second, 50,000 rupees for the third, 25,000 rupees for the fourth and 15,000 rupees for the fifth. 

Langtang Trail Run Coordinator Gaganraj Neupan said that the trail run was organized with the aim of promoting the natural beauty of the Langtang region and developing adventure tourism.  106 athletes participated in the competition, which was organized with the support of the Bagmati Province Ministry of Culture and Tourism. Of these, 18 were women and 88 were men.
